Bausch Health (NYSE:BHC) FY Conference Transcript
2026-01-15 00:47
Summary of Bausch Health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Bausch Health - **Key Executives Present**: Tom Appio (CEO), J.J. Charhon (CFO), Jonathan Sadeh (CMO) - **Revenue**: $4.8 billion in 2024 - **Adjusted EBITDA**: $2.5 billion - **Adjusted Cash Flow from Operations**: $1.3 million [3][2] Strategic Focus - **Profitable Growth**: Emphasis on both top-line and bottom-line growth [2] - **Capital Structure Improvement**: Refinanced $9.5 billion of debt to enhance maturity profile and reduce debt [2] - **Investment in People and Processes**: Focus on building a strong team and developing product portfolios [2] Business Segments - **Salix**: Focused on GI and hepatology, with a 12% revenue growth reported in Q3 2025 [6][8] - **Solta Medical**: Global aesthetics franchise, with significant growth in Asia-Pacific, particularly a 30% CAGR in South Korea and 40% CAGR in China [10][22] - **International Segment**: Diverse portfolio of branded generic products, with strong performance in Central Europe and Mexico [12][19] - **Neuroscience**: Second largest contributor to sales in the U.S., with consistent quarterly revenue growth [13][29] Market Opportunities - **GI and Hepatology**: Over 4.5 million people diagnosed with liver disease in the U.S. [7] - **Neuroscience Market**: Estimated at $20 billion in the U.S. [7] - **Global Aesthetics Market**: Over $20 billion, with Solta positioned in significant subcategories [7] Product Performance - **Xifaxan**: Leading treatment for hepatic encephalopathy, with over 40% of patients treated; 9% growth in total scripts in Q3 [8][18] - **Solta Products**: Achieved over 5 million treatments in 2025, with multiple award-winning devices [10][11] Future Growth Drivers - **Red Sea Program**: Focused on preventing overt hepatic encephalopathy, with a larger patient population than current treatments [16][32] - **Larsucosterol**: Acquired late-stage modulator for severe alcohol-associated hepatitis, with a phase three trial initiated [17][35] Financial Outlook - **Guidance**: Reiterating guidance leaning towards the higher end of the range, reflecting strong operating momentum [14] - **Debt Management**: Plans to reduce debt further, especially post-Xifaxan LOE in 2028 [25][26] Business Development Strategy - **Acquisitions**: Recent acquisition of a distributor in China to enhance market reach [5] - **Focus Areas**: Targeting therapeutic areas of GI, hepatology, neuroscience, dermatology, and aesthetics for future acquisitions [27][28] Innovation and Execution - **AI-Driven Insights**: Implemented an AI engine to enhance targeting and messaging for Xifaxan, contributing to growth [30] - **Data Generation**: Emphasis on generating strong clinical data to support product efficacy and safety [23][22] Conclusion - **Strong Foundation**: Bausch Health operates in attractive segments with significant growth potential, driven by a dedicated management team and a focus on innovation and execution [18][34]

Bausch Health Announces Final Results and Expiration of Exchange Offers
Accessnewswire· 2025-12-23 22:35
Core Viewpoint - Bausch Health Companies Inc. and its subsidiary announced the final results and expiration of their offers to exchange existing senior secured notes for new senior secured notes totaling up to $1.6 billion [1] Group 1: Exchange Offer Details - The company is exchanging its outstanding 4.875% Senior Secured Notes due 2028 and 11.00% Senior Secured Notes due 2028 for up to $1.6 billion aggregate principal amount of new 10.00% Senior Secured Notes due 2032 [1] - The offers were conducted according to the terms outlined in a confidential exchange offer memorandum dated November 24, 2025 [1]
Bausch Health's Slow Rebuild Faces New Scrutiny After Lombard Odier Cuts Its Stake
The Motley Fool· 2025-12-11 03:59
Core Insights - Bausch Health's valuation indicates potential for recovery, but recent stake reduction by Lombard Odier Asset Management highlights ongoing investor skepticism regarding the company's ability to regain full confidence [1][9]. Company Overview - Bausch Health Companies Inc. is a global healthcare entity with a diverse product portfolio that includes pharmaceuticals, medical devices, and consumer health products, focusing on eye health, gastroenterology, dermatology, and international markets [4][5]. - The company generates revenue through the development, manufacturing, and distribution of both branded and generic drugs, as well as medical devices and consumer health products across various therapeutic segments [5]. Recent Developments - Lombard Odier Asset Management reduced its stake in Bausch Health by 3,334,000 shares in Q3 2025, decreasing its position's value to approximately $11.07 million, which now represents 0.74% of the fund's reportable assets, down from 2.6% in the previous quarter [2][3][6]. - As of November 13, 2025, Bausch Health shares were priced at $6.62, reflecting a 24.6% decline over the past year, significantly underperforming the S&P 500 by 40.08 percentage points [3]. Financial Metrics - Market capitalization of Bausch Health is approximately $2.34 billion, with a trailing twelve months (TTM) revenue of $8.26 billion and a TTM net income of $362 million [3]. Strategic Challenges - The company operates with a mature product portfolio that generates cash but struggles to deliver the necessary growth to support its substantial debt load, raising concerns about its long-term financial flexibility [10]. - Bausch Health's established franchises were not designed to sustain high leverage for extended periods, and the ongoing challenge is whether cash generation can exceed interest costs and legal liabilities [10]. Future Outlook - The company's ability to improve its financial situation hinges on successful refinancing, effective cash conversion, and strategies to reduce leverage without divesting key assets [11].

BHC Stock Up as Solta Acquires Shibo's Aesthetics Distribution Business
ZACKS· 2025-12-02 20:20
Core Insights - Bausch Health, Inc. (BHC) shares increased by 11% following the announcement of the acquisition of Wuhan Shibo Zhenmei Technology Co., Ltd. [1] - The acquisition allows Solta Medical, a subsidiary of Bausch Health, to take full control of its distribution in China, enhancing its market presence and operational efficiency [2][7] - The Chinese aesthetics market is rapidly growing, positioning Solta Medical to meet increasing demand for aesthetic treatments [3] Company Performance - Bausch Health reported better-than-expected third-quarter results for 2025, driven by its Salix and Solta businesses [4] - Solta Medical achieved revenues of $140 million, reflecting a 25% year-over-year increase, with a 24% organic growth primarily from the Asia Pacific region [8] - Despite recent gains, Bausch Health's shares have declined by 12.5% year-to-date, contrasting with the industry's growth of 23.7% [6] Financial Position - As of September 30, 2025, Bausch Health's long-term debt stood at $21 billion, with a cash balance of $1.3 billion [10]
Bausch Health Companies Inc. (BHC) Presents at Evercore 8th Annual Healthcare Conference Transcript
Seeking Alpha· 2025-12-02 17:43
Company Overview - The company is a global diversified pharmaceutical and medical devices entity serving over 70 markets [2] - It was founded in 1959, but the current configuration has been in place since 2015 due to significant acquisitions, including Salix Pharmaceutical and Bausch + Lomb [2] - The acquisitions have primarily been financed through debt, which is a relevant aspect of the company's financial story [2] Business Segments - The company operates in five different segments, including Bausch + Lomb [3] - Excluding Bausch + Lomb, the company has a strong presence in the U.S. pharmaceutical market through the Salix business and a diversified portfolio [3] - The International segment includes platforms in Europe, Latin America, and Canada, with a focus on Eastern European markets in Europe and a strong presence in Latin America [3]
